Develop a Comprehensive Cleansing Checklist



Producing a detailed cleansing list can make your Airbnb turn over process smoother and a lot more efficient. Start by noting all areas in your space, including rooms, shower rooms, kitchen, and living locations. Damage down each location right into specific tasks. For instance, in the kitchen, consist of cleaning down counter tops, cleaning appliances, and washing meals.


Do not neglect the details-- look for dirt on surfaces, tidy mirrors, and vacuum carpetings. Include laundry tasks like changing sheets and towels, as fresh linens can leave a long-term impression.


Take into consideration adding an evaluation step at the end of your cleaning routine. This assures nothing's ignored and helps maintain consistency. By following this checklist, you'll enhance your cleaning procedure, reduce stress and anxiety, and ensure your guests get here to a pristine environment. And also, a tidy home enhances visitor complete satisfaction and urges favorable testimonials, which is important for your Airbnb success.

Make Use Of the Right Cleansing Products



After taking on the high-traffic areas, it's time to reflect on the cleansing products you utilize. Picking the ideal cleaning products can make all the difference in accomplishing a clean area that wows your guests.


Don't ignore anti-bacterials-- particularly in restrooms and kitchens. Ensure they're EPA-approved for maximum performance versus germs. Microfiber fabrics are important for cleaning and cleaning down surface areas given that they catch dirt without scratching.


For floorings, discover a cleaner ideal for your floor covering kind, whether it's tile, hardwood, or laminate. Ultimately, take into consideration adding a pleasurable aroma with air fresheners or necessary oils, as a fresh-smelling area improves the general experience. Your choice of products can genuinely elevate your Airbnb's tidiness and atmosphere.

Maintain a Consistent Cleaning Arrange



Keeping a regular cleaning routine is important for keeping Airbnb cleaning your Airbnb in leading form and ensuring visitor fulfillment. By establishing a routine cleaning routine, you create a reputable environment for your guests, which helps develop count on and urges favorable testimonials. Begin by figuring out a cleaning regularity that suits your property and guest turn over.


After each guest's remain, designate time for thorough cleaning, consisting of dusting, vacuuming, and sterilizing high-touch locations. Do not neglect to examine towels and bed linens, ensuring they're fresh and clean for the next arrival.


In addition to post-checkout cleansing, think about organizing regular maintenance tasks, such as deep cleansing carpetings or windows. This will protect against dirt accumulation and maintain your home looking pristine.


Ultimately, stick to your schedule as closely as feasible. Uniformity not just improves your visitors' experience yet also mirrors your commitment to high quality friendliness.

Often Asked Questions



How Frequently Should I Deep Tidy My Airbnb Residential Or Commercial Property?



You need to deep cleanse your Airbnb home at least once a month. If you have high turnover or pets, take into consideration doing it much more frequently. Routine deep cleaning maintains your room fresh and welcoming for guests.


What Are Eco-Friendly Cleaning Product Options?



When you're selecting eco-friendly cleansing items, think about alternatives like vinegar, cooking soda, and castile soap. They work, risk-free for your guests, and much better for the environment. You'll be amazed at their cleaning power!


Exactly How Can I Handle Cleaning After an Animal Remain?



After a family pet remain, vacuum cleaner completely to eliminate hair, use enzyme cleaners for stains, and wash all bed linens. Don't neglect to air out the space and look for any lingering smells to ensure quality.


Should I Hire Professional Cleansers or Do It Myself?



You ought to consider your time and budget. Working with experts could be best if you're busy or want a comprehensive clean. Doing it on your own can save money. if you take pleasure in cleaning up and have the time.


Just How Can I Minimize Cleaning Time In Between Visitors?



To lessen cleansing time in between guests, develop a checklist, declutter consistently, use multi-purpose cleansers, and maintain necessary materials equipped. Prioritize high-traffic areas and consider a cleaning schedule to improve your procedure successfully.
